101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ples
101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ples
101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ples
101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ples
Book Details
  • ISBN: 979-8312705201
  • Published: March 2, 2025
  • Categories: Books Computers & Technology Games & Strategy Guides
Editors Choice

101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ples

Limited Time Offer: Get 30% off when you order through our Amazon link!

About This Book

101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ples is a groundbreaking exploration of programming that has captivated readers worldwide. With 1953+ copies sold, this essential read offers unparalleled insights into programming.

Why You'll Love It

  • Comprehensive coverage of javascript
  • 10 chapters packed with fascinating theories
  • Perfect for professionals in the field
  • Includes interactive exercises

In the News

Trump strikes “wild” deal making US firms pay 15% tax on China chip sales

The deal won’t resolve national security concerns. ...

Source: arstechnica.com - Mon, 11 Aug 2025 16:31:51 +0000
The DHS Wants You to Forget That Anakin Skywalker Also Descended Into Fascism

Once again, the U.S. government doesn't quite grasp the meanings behind 'Star Wars.'...

Source: www.gizmodo.com - Mon, 11 Aug 2025 16:31:06 +0000
More News

Reader Reviews

4.6
★ ★ ★ ★ ★

Based on 12 reviews

5 stars (82%)
4 stars (24%)
3 stars (1%)
1-2 stars (1%)
David Rodriguez
David Rodriguez
★ ★ ★ ★ ★

May 8, 2025

Fantastic book! Clear, concise, and packed with useful information about shader. Highly recommended!

James Rodriguez
James Rodriguez
★ ★ ★ ★ ★

March 18, 2025

Fantastic book! Clear, concise, and packed with useful information about shader. Highly recommended!

David Johnson
David Johnson
★ ★ ★ ★ ★

June 26, 2025

Fantastic book! Clear, concise, and packed with useful information about shader. Highly recommended!

Jessica Garcia
Jessica Garcia
★ ★ ★ ☆ ☆

February 25, 2025

While 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ples makes several valuable points about shader, I found some aspects problematic. The author's treatment of ray-tracing seems oversimplified, particularly when compared to graphics. That said, the sections on ray-tracing are genuinely insightful and make the book worth reading despite its flaws. With some refinement in ai, this could be a truly outstanding work.

David Smith
David Smith
★ ★ ★ ★ ★

July 6, 2025

101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ples is a comprehensive exploration of programming that manages to be both accessible to newcomers and valuable to experts. The book is divided into 3 sections, each building thoughtfully on the last. Part 2's discussion of shader is particularly strong, with clear examples and practical applications. The diagrams and illustrations throughout help clarify complex ideas, and the chapter summaries are excellent for review. My only minor critique is that the pacing could be better, but this doesn't detract from the overall quality. This will undoubtedly become a standard reference in the field.

Recommended Books

Visualizing Data: Psychology and Analytics - Exploring, Explaining and Storytelling (Paperback)
Visualizing Data: Psychology and Analytics - Exploring, Explaining and Storytelling (Paperback)
★ ★ ★ ★ ★
View Details
NodeJS in 20 Minutes: (Coffee Break Series)
NodeJS in 20 Minutes: (Coffee Break Series)
★ ★ ★ ★ ☆
View Details
Learn Batch Scripting in 20 Minutes: (Coffee Break Series)
Learn Batch Scripting in 20 Minutes: (Coffee Break Series)
★ ★ ★ ★ ★
View Details
WebGPU Compute
WebGPU Compute
★ ★ ★ ★ ★ ☆
View Details
WebGPU API - Owners' Workshop Manual - Computer Programming (Beginners Onwards): Everything You Need To Get Started With Programming Using WebGPU API And WGSL Shader Language
WebGPU API - Owners' Workshop Manual - Computer Programming (Beginners Onwards): Everything You Need To Get Started With Programming Using WebGPU API And WGSL Shader Language
★ ★ ★ ★ ★ ☆
View Details

Community Discussions

James Williams
Discussion about graphics in 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ples

Posted by James Williams on July 30, 2025

Just finished 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ples for the 10 time and picked up on so many new insights! The depth of research on ray-tracing is incredible.

Lisa Rodriguez

Lisa Rodriguez August 10,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Lisa Davis

Lisa Davis August 4,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Thomas Smith
Discussion about ai in 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ples

Posted by Thomas Smith on July 24, 2025

I've been applying the principles from 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ples to my work in programming and seeing amazing results! Specifically, the part about ai has been transformative.

David Brown

David Brown July 28, 2025

This reminds me of a similar condept from somewhere.

James Wilson

James Wilson August 5,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

David Brown

David Brown August 5,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

James Miller

James Miller July 28,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Robert Williams

Robert Williams August 8,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Lisa Davis
Discussion about javascript in 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ples

Posted by Lisa Davis on July 31, 2025

I've been applying the principles from 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ples to my work in programming and seeing amazing results! Specifically, the part about visualization has been transformative.

Robert Smith

Robert Smith July 29,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Thomas Johnson

Thomas Johnson August 10, 2025

Interesting perspective. I hadn't considered that angle before.

Jessica Smith

Jessica Smith July 31, 2025

Interesting perspective. I hadn't considered that angle before.

Sarah Williams

Sarah Williams August 6, 2025

This reminds me of a similar condept from somewhere.

James Garcia

James Garcia August 3, 2025

I completely agree! This was my experience as well.

Jennifer Williams
Discussion about programming in 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ples

Posted by Jennifer Williams on July 29, 2025

Discussion: What did everyone think of the author's treatment of javascript? I found it more accessible compared to other works in the field.

Robert Rodriguez

Robert Rodriguez August 9,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Sarah Davis

Sarah Davis July 30,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Sarah Jones

Sarah Jones July 29, 2025

This reminds me of a similar condept from somewhere.

David Davis

David Davis August 10, 2025

This reminds me of a similar condept from somewhere.

Jessica Wilson

Jessica Wilson August 1, 2025

To add to this, I found similar examples which seems to support your point.

Michael Jones
Discussion about ai in 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ples

Posted by Michael Jones on July 29, 2025

Just finished 101 Ray-Tracing, Ray-Marching and Path-Tracing Projects: A Hands-On Journey Through 101 Programming Project Examples for the 1 time and picked up on so many new insights! The depth of research on ai is incredible.

Lisa Garcia

Lisa Garcia July 28, 2025

I completely agree! This was my experience as well.

Sarah Davis

Sarah Davis August 3, 2025

This reminds me of a similar condept from somewhere.

Lisa Smith

Lisa Smith August 2, 2025

Interesting perspective. I hadn't considered that angle before.

David Miller

David Miller August 7, 2025

Could you elaborate on what you mean by this? I'm not sure I follow.

Jessica Brown

Jessica Brown August 5, 2025

This reminds me of a similar condept from somewhere.